Watch the sunset in silence for twenty minutes.
That's the entire practice. Thousands are already doing it.
No app to download. No mantra to learn. No teacher to find. Just you, the sky, and forty minutes of quiet. Here's the whole thing:
Check the sunrise and sunset times at the top of this page. Pick whichever is closer. Get yourself outside where you can see the horizon — a beach, a rooftop, a hill, even a west-facing window. You don't need a sacred space. You need a clear sightline.
This is the hard part for about 90 seconds. Then it's the best part. No music, no podcasts, no "just quickly checking." The doctrine calls restraint sacred. This is where it starts — with your own attention.
At sunrise, the first edge breaks through and the world shifts from pre-dawn to day. At sunset, the last sliver disappears and something in the air changes — temperature, color, sound. It's been happening for 4.6 billion years. You're choosing to notice. That's the whole religion.
Don't leave right away. Don't check your phone. Most people say the clarity hits here — in the quiet after, not during. Your mind settles in a way it hasn't all day. It's not spiritual. It's what happens when a nervous system recalibrates in natural light instead of to a screen.
That's the whole architecture. Repetition, not intensity. A week in, you'll notice changes. A month in, other people might notice before you do. The practice deepens not because you had a breakthrough — but because you returned.
